Heatmap Ethics and Privacy for Ecommerce

Running heatmaps on your store means collecting behavioral data from real people. Done right, it is legal, ethical, and valuable. Done wrong, it can expose you to GDPR fines, erode customer trust, and create legal liability. This collection covers what you need to know about consent, data retention, and responsible heatmap use.
